Checking your driving record in Guam can be effectively accomplished by requesting it from the Transportation Licensing Center (TLC) either through their offices or on their website. The TLC is the designated authority responsible for managing driving records and issuing licenses in the region, making them the most reliable source for that information. This process is designed to ensure that the records are accurate and securely managed, allowing individuals to easily access their driving history.
